South Tyrol (and the Eastern Alps) offers many high summits and glaciers above 3,000 metres. Choosing the right tour can be difficult here. Trust our local mountain guides, and we will find the ideal tour for your requirements and physical ability.
For many ski tourers, spring is the finest time to enjoy their favourite sport. Snow cover and, above all, the base are good, avalanche danger is practically non-existent with good timing, and the rush on the snow-covered mountains has also eased considerably. It is also the time to go for the big summit objectives.
Those who bring the motivation to set out early, and on top of that have the necessary fitness to manage the long ascents, will be rewarded with a unique experience. With a bit of luck, we will carve almost effortlessly back down into the valley in perfect corn snow conditions.

What you need
Requirements:
- Fitness for at least 1,200 meters of ascent – the sky's the limit ;)
- Confident off-piste skiing
- Safe and reasonably energy-efficient switchbacks

PROGRAM
Day tour: Individual ski mountaineering tour
Depending on the chosen tour, we arrange a meeting point and usually an early start time for our ski mountaineering tour. After a short equipment check, we begin our ascent by headlamp or in the first daylight. Along the way there is a beautiful sunrise, and the early start is long forgotten as soon as the sun bathes the snow-covered mountains in golden light. The constantly changing play of light and colour at daybreak makes the time on the ascent fly by, and we quickly gain altitude. On the summit we enjoy a panorama that only the high peaks can offer. Hardly any higher mountains block the view all the way to the horizon, across thousands of summits and new objectives. In favourable conditions and with the right timing, we enjoy magnificent corn snow descents and return almost effortlessly to the valley, where a cold drink awaits us on some sunny terrace.

F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TIONS - (FAQs)
Who is this individual ski mountaineering tour offer for?
This offer is aimed at ski tourers looking for a suitable ski mountaineering tour in South Tyrol or the Eastern Alps and who value a tour choice that matches their fitness and experience. Objective, length, and requirements are tailored individually.
When is the best time for a ski mountaineering tour to the big summits?
The best time is spring: good snow cover, often a stable base, and with good timing very fine corn snow conditions. In addition, many major summit objectives are especially appealing at that time.
